在当前大数据与商业智能(BI)领域快速发展的背景下,企业对数据整合与分析的需求日益增长,Pentaho作为开源ETL(数据抽取、转换、加载)和BI解决方案的核心工具,其技术人才的市场需求持续攀升,Pentaho招聘不仅关注候选人的技术硬实力,更强调实际项目经验与问题解决能力,以下从岗位职责、技能要求、职业发展及行业趋势等方面展开详细分析。
Pentaho相关岗位通常涵盖数据工程师、BI开发工程师、ETL开发工程师等核心职位,其核心职责围绕数据 pipeline 构建、可视化报表开发及数据治理展开,以数据工程师为例,日常工作包括使用Pentaho Data Integration(Kettle)设计、开发和维护ETL流程,确保数据从源系统到数据仓库的高效流转;处理数据质量问题,如去重、格式转换、异常值清洗等,保障数据准确性;配合业务部门需求,通过Pentaho CDE(Community Dashboard Editor)或Pentaho Report Designer开发交互式仪表盘和定制化报表,支持业务决策,岗位还需涉及Pentaho Server的部署与维护,如集群配置、性能优化及安全策略实施,确保BI平台的稳定运行。
在技能要求方面,Pentaho招聘对候选人的技术栈呈现“深度+广度”的双重标准,硬技能上,熟练掌握Pentaho Kettle是基础,需熟悉其核心组件(如Transformation、Job)的设计与调试,能独立处理复杂的数据关联逻辑(如多表Join、分区分桶);熟悉SQL语言,包括存储过程、函数编写及复杂查询优化,尤其在大数据场景下(如Hive、Spark SQL)的经验更受青睐;了解数据仓库建模理论(如星型模型、雪花模型),能结合业务需求设计合理的维度表和事实表,企业普遍要求候选人具备Linux操作系统操作经验,掌握Shell脚本编写,以支持ETL任务的自动化调度;熟悉ETL工具(如Informatica、Talend)或大数据技术栈(Hadoop、Flink)者更具竞争力,软技能方面,良好的沟通能力与跨部门协作经验至关重要,因Pentaho项目常需与业务、IT团队紧密配合,准确理解需求并转化为技术方案;问题排查能力与抗压能力也备受关注,面对数据量激增或系统故障时,需快速定位并解决问题。
职业发展路径上,Pentaho技术人才通常呈现“技术专家+管理双通道”趋势,初级工程师可专注于ETL开发与报表实现,积累项目经验后向高级工程师进阶,负责复杂架构设计与性能优化;部分候选人转向BI架构师,主导企业级数据平台规划,整合Pentaho与其他工具(如Tableau、Python)构建全流程解决方案;管理方向则可发展为数据团队负责人,统筹项目交付与团队培养,薪资水平因城市、企业规模及经验差异较大,一线城市(如北京、上海)3-5年经验者年薪普遍在20-40万元,资深架构师或管理岗可达50万元以上。
行业趋势方面,随着云计算与AI技术的融合,Pentaho招聘需求呈现新特点,企业更倾向候选人具备云平台(如AWS、Azure)上的Pentaho部署经验,了解容器化(Docker、Kubernetes)部署与Serverless架构;AI能力成为加分项,如通过Python结合Pentaho实现数据智能分析,或使用机器学习算法优化ETL流程的异常检测,数据安全与合规性(如GDPR、数据脱敏)逐渐成为岗位刚需,要求候选人熟悉数据加密、访问控制等技术,确保数据处理过程符合行业规范。
相关问答FAQs
-
问:Pentaho岗位是否必须具备Java开发能力?
答:并非所有岗位强制要求Java基础,但掌握Java能显著提升竞争力,Pentaho Kettle的Java插件开发、自定义组件编写以及Pentaho Server的二次开发均需Java技能,若目标岗位涉及平台定制或复杂扩展,Java经验(尤其是Spring框架)是重要加分项;若专注于ETL流程设计与报表开发,SQL、Kettle操作及数据仓库知识更为核心。 -
问:零经验转行Pentaho需要准备哪些技能?
答:零经验转行需系统学习“理论基础+工具实操+项目经验”,首先掌握数据库原理(MySQL、Oracle)和SQL进阶知识,再学习Pentaho Kettle基础操作(通过官方文档或在线课程);同时补充数据仓库建模(如《数据仓库工具箱》)、ETL设计模式等理论;建议通过个人项目(如模拟电商数据ETL流程)积累实践经验,熟悉从数据抽取到报表输出的全流程,面试时突出学习能力和问题解决思路,部分企业对接受实习或培训的候选人会适当放宽经验要求。
